L.A. Times Wins Top Honors for Innovative Newsletter Portfolio
																								
												
												
											The Los Angeles Times secured first place in the 2025 Online Journalism Awards (OJA) for its comprehensive portfolio of newsletters. The awards, presented by the Online News Association, honor outstanding achievements in storytelling, technical innovation, and community impact within digital journalism. The announcement was made during a virtual awards ceremony held on August 28, 2025.
Winning in the category for excellence in newsletters (portfolio), the Times showcased a suite of publications, including Essential California, The Wild, L.A. on the Record, Dodgers Dugout, and In Case of Fire. The recognition highlights the newspaper’s commitment to engaging its audience through diverse and informative content.
Karim Doumar, head of newsletters at the Los Angeles Times, expressed his enthusiasm for the accolade, stating, “We are thrilled to see The Times’ newsletters recognized by the Online Journalism Awards. Our newsletter program continues to grow in ambition and success, and this honor is a reflection of that hard work.”
In the submission for the award, Doumar underscored the significance of fostering connections between reporters and their audience. He articulated that the Times’ newsletter portfolio is founded on the belief that “voice and thoughtful relationships between writers and our readers are the future.” This perspective aligns with the evolving landscape of digital journalism, where direct engagement with readers is increasingly vital.
Among the Times’ offerings, The Wild was also recognized as a finalist in the excellence in newsletters (single newsletter) category. Authored by staff writer Jaclyn Cosgrove, this weekly newsletter serves as a guide for Los Angeles’ enthusiastic urban outdoor community. It highlights opportunities for exploration, education, and coexistence with the city’s natural surroundings.
